Isaac Hanson, Taylor Hanson and Zak Hanson formed their band in 1992, and while they’ve never stopped performing, over the years they’ve all taken on new roles – fatherhood!
The band has 15 children between them – Isaac is a father of three, Taylor is a father of seven, and Zac is a parent of five – and the majority of their children go by their middle names, following family tradition. (Isaac’s first name is Clarke, Taylor’s is Jordan.)
Taylor was the first of his brothers to start a family and welcomed him and his wife Natalie Hansoneldest son, Ezra, in 2002. Daughter Penelope arrived three years later, followed by River, Viggo, Wilhelmina, and Indy. Their seventh child (and third daughter), Maybebellene, was born in 2020.
Taylor stumbled over Parents of today in November 2017 on the benefits of a “bigger family,” explaining, “Everyone develops this innate ability to compromise, work with others, and realize that the whole world doesn’t revolve around you. It also encourages you to be an individual as you can clearly see your differences from a sibling. I see that with my children: they are very different, but I see that they love and respect each other.”
He went on to say that his kids were like “a crew” as they had been touring with their dad and uncles since they were little.

As for Isaac and Zac, the brothers have three and five children respectively. Isaac shares sons Everett and Monroe and daughter Odette with his wife, Nicole Hansonwhile Zac and wife Kathryn Hanson are the parents of sons Shepherd, Abraham and Quincy and daughters Junia and Lucille.
